Juihi wrote: Ahhhh I had wondered if that might be the case, such scumbag moves That's the basic challenge with ovals under the current model: finding ovals that: A) Are not ISC (NASCAR) or SMI owned, because neither has done a good job with Indy race promos in the past, and some have even work actively against the series at times. B) Are not NASCARized, because many changes done for the Cup cars have produced less than stellar racing for Indycar. That being said, the Iowa "let's pair with some Nashville country artists" angle this year is interesting. I think some of the lack of success on ovals has been bad promotion, as well as a schedule that is too dependent on just the Indycar race (no other entertainment, no support series, etc.) Maybe Penske can find a new formula that works for the ovals like the one they have for the street and road courses. The current model only works when you have an enthusiastic promoter (eg Gateway). |

Quote: During last year’s inaugural NTT INDYCAR SERIES race in Nashville, the restarts occurred at the finish line in front of Nissan Stadium but this August will move to the long straightaway as the field exits the Korean War Veterans Memorial Bridge and toward Turn 9. It will be the same zone that was used for the start of each race last season and should provide cleaner restarts and more immediate passing opportunities. Quote: Other modifications or changes to the 2.17-mile, 11-turn temporary street circuit include: Turn 11 apex being opened approximately 6 feet to not only increase the track width but provide better vision for drivers. Transition areas at both ends of the Korean War Veterans Memorial Bridge being smoothed as much as possible to reduce the potential of the cars bottoming coming on and off the bridge. Resurfacing at the Turn 5 apex to minimize the bump. Track width into Turn 9 being reduced to 50 feet to accommodate additional suites in a primary viewing area. https://www.indycar.com/news/2022/04/04-18-nashville-changes |

Hopefully the last story from Pruett on car 33 before confirmation; https://racer.com/2022/04/21/pruett-ind ... continues/ tl;dr -The entry list will be 33 - any push for a 34th has been abandoned. -Plan A was indeed a second JHR car for RHR alongside Ilott - but RHR decided against it to focus on coaching Ilott instead. -Plan B (JHR loaning their chassis to someone else) has also fallen by the wayside. -Plan C is now in play - Foyt have been tapped to lend one of their chassis (the one used by Kimball last year) to DragonSpeed, who have a full crew assembled. -Cusick and Wilson are also involved, putting up the money to make it happen. So Wilson would be the driver. -Should Foyt ultimately say no, the last ditch plan D would be for DragonSpeed and Cusick to go back to Juncos and beg\borrow\steal one of their spare tubs. |
